SCMA Ham Radio Net

Everyone is invited to listen to or (if you have a Ham Radio license) check into the weekly net. We have MOVED the net to Thursday nights at 7:30 PM on the W6NVY repeaters. On 2 meters: 147.195, + Offset, PL 100.0. On 440: 449.700, - Offset, PL 131.8. The two repeaters are linked together during the net.

This is a combined net of the SCMA, the Los Angeles Unified School District ARA, and the Westside Amateur Radio Club.

During the net we will take check-ins, have club announcements, and play the latest Newsline recording.

LAFD Fireboat Tour May 14th

Thanks to our friends at the Los Angeles City Fire Department, there will be an SCMA tour of LAFD Station 112, including Fireboat 2, in the L.A. Harbor on Sunday May 14th beginning at 10:00 AM.

Station 112 is home to LAFD's newest Fireboat, Boat 2, the Warner Lawrence, the most powerful fireboat in the world.
